Nigerias corona Virus Outbreak could purse 5000000 people into poverty as it triggers the worst recession in the country in decades the World Bank Says the shock of the pandemic and the Global Oil Price crass has been devastating for africas largest economy nigeria also has the highest number of People Living in extreme poverty in the world and has not recovered from another recession in 2016 more than 22000 virus cases and 500 deaths have been reported in nigeria so far. House of representatives is debating a Sweeping Police Reform bill brought by the democrats the legislation would reduce Legal Protections for officers and would make it easier to prosecute police it will also ban chokeholds and change the criteria for using lethal force on wednesday a republican bill on Police Reform was rejected democrats say didnt go far enough this follows nationwide protests calling for change after the death of george floyd.
